2017-05-08 kassoulet <email address hidden>
* configure.ac: Update version to 3.0.0-beta1
2017-05-08 kassoulet <email address hidden>
* soundconverter/gstreamer.py: Stop sorting tasks by duration, this
is wrong for now - all tasks may not have duration ready at start - UI is not prepared for this, we have to remove per-task progress if we really want this
2017-05-08 kassoulet <email address hidden>
* soundconverter/gstreamer.py: Less verbose output
2017-04-26 kassoulet <email address hidden>
* soundconverter/ui.py: Create temporary file in destination folder Thus renaming at the end is just a move instead of a slow copy. And
source folder is untouched.
2017-04-26 kassoulet <email address hidden>
* soundconverter/fileoperations.py, tests/unittests.py: Fix URI
encoding (again and again)
2017-04-26 kassoulet <email address hidden>
* soundconverter/fileoperations.py, soundconverter/gstreamer.py: Fix
debug prints
2017-04-26 kassoulet <email address hidden>
* soundconverter/fileoperations.py: Fix vfs_walk
2017-01-26 kassoulet <email address hidden>
* tests/unittests.py: Change unittests to be more python-like
2017-01-12 kassoulet <email address hidden>
* data/soundconverter.appdata.xml: Update appdata
2017-01-12 kassoulet <email address hidden>
* soundconverter/gstreamer.py: Prevent name collision
2017-01-12 kassoulet <email address hidden>
* configure.ac, po/Makefile.in.in, po/POTFILES.in, po/ar.po,
po/ast.po, po/bg.po, po/br.po, po/ca.po, po/cs.po, po/da.po,
po/de.po, po/el.po, po/en_AU.po, po/en_CA.po, po/en_GB.po,
po/eo.po, po/es.po, po/et.po, po/eu.po, po/fa.po, po/fi.po,
po/fr.po, po/fr_CA.po, po/fr_FR.po, po/gl.po, po/he.po, po/hi.po,
po/hu.po, po/it.po, po/ja.po, po/ko.po, po/lt.po, po/lv.po,
po/ml.po, po/ms.po, po/nb.po, po/nl.po, po/pl.po, po/pt.po,
po/pt_BR.po, po/ru.po, po/sk.po, po/sl.po, po/soundconverter.pot,
po/sq.po, po/sr.po, <email address hidden>, <email address hidden>, po/sv.po,
po/te.po, po/tr.po, po/uk.po, po/vi.po, po/zh_CN.po, po/zh_TW.po:
Update translations
2017-01-12 kassoulet <email address hidden>
* README, bin/soundconverter.py, data/soundconverter.glade,
soundconverter/__init__.py, soundconverter/batch.py,
soundconverter/error.py, soundconverter/fileoperations.py,
soundconverter/gconfstore.py, soundconverter/gstreamer.py,
soundconverter/namegenerator.py, soundconverter/notify.py,
soundconverter/queue.py, soundconverter/settings.py,
soundconverter/soundfile.py, soundconverter/task.py,
soundconverter/ui.py, soundconverter/utils.py: update year
2016-10-25 kassoulet <email address hidden>
* soundconverter/ui.py: Fix progress updated while converter is not
running
2016-10-25 kassoulet <email address hidden>
* soundconverter/ui.py: Fix Add-Folders, ignored selected file type
2016-10-25 kassoulet <email address hidden>
* soundconverter/gstreamer.py, soundconverter/namegenerator.py,
soundconverter/settings.py, soundconverter/ui.py: Use album-artist
tag for folders
2016-10-25 kassoulet <email address hidden>
* soundconverter/soundfile.py: Fix GObject.filename_display_name
deprecated
2016-09-02 kassoulet <email address hidden>
* configure.ac: bump version number
2016-09-02 kassoulet <email address hidden>
* soundconverter/ui.py: Remove unused code
2016-09-02 kassoulet <email address hidden>
* soundconverter/fileoperations.py,
soundconverter/namegenerator.py, soundconverter/ui.py: Fix uri quote
issue with destination folder Closes lp:1594698, thanks Richard.
2016-09-02 kassoulet <email address hidden>
* soundconverter/gstreamer.py: Fix opus vbr setting Closes lp:1097610, thanks Alexander.
2016-09-02 kassoulet <email address hidden>
* soundconverter/task.py: Remove debug print
2016-08-19 kassoulet <email address hidden>
* soundconverter/fileoperations.py: Remove unwanted log()
2016-08-19 kassoulet <email address hidden>
* soundconverter/fileoperations.py: Fix crash when destination
folder doesn't exist make unquote_filename works with GLocalFiles Closes lp:1614466, thanks Rey Leonard.
2016-08-10 kassoulet <email address hidden>
* soundconverter/ui.py: Make sure title is reset correctly after
conversion
2016-08-10 kassoulet <email address hidden>
* README, bin/soundconverter.py, data/soundconverter.glade,
soundconverter/__init__.py, soundconverter/batch.py,
soundconverter/error.py, soundconverter/fileoperations.py,
soundconverter/gconfstore.py, soundconverter/gstreamer.py,
soundconverter/namegenerator.py, soundconverter/notify.py,
soundconverter/queue.py, soundconverter/settings.py,
soundconverter/soundfile.py, soundconverter/task.py,
soundconverter/ui.py, soundconverter/utils.py: Update copyright year
2016-08-10 kassoulet <email address hidden>
* : commit 68c360fbf224a8f3e8cd872e5b1dbcca9acdd902 Author:
kassoulet <email address hidden> Date: Wed Aug 10 11:37:54
2016 +0200
2016-08-10 kassoulet <email address hidden>
* soundconverter/gstreamer.py: filenametags: Fix datetime reading
2016-07-07 Sebastian Ramacher <email address hidden>
* autogen.sh, configure.ac: Migrate away from gnome-common gnome-common is deprecated. Replaced gnome-common usage according to
https://wiki.gnome.org/Projects/GnomeCommon/Migration.
2016-05-08 Gautier Portet <email address hidden>
* : Merge pull request #15 from xavery/sort-by-duration Sort the conversion tasks in descending order according to duration
2016-05-05 kassoulet <email address hidden>
* soundconverter/gstreamer.py: wav: Fix sample size with new gst1.0
syntax. Closes lp:1577777, Thanks Leon.
2016-04-04 Gautier Portet <email address hidden>
* : Merge pull request #14 from Mailaender/patch-1 Add a missing Desktop sub-category
2016-01-07 kassoulet <email address hidden>
* soundconverter/fileoperations.py: Fix filename quoting when there
are "funny" characters Closes lp:1524487